Output 43cacc114b1ee15dea30266f91432f20ba3abfd596bc934651d9827899836b96:7

value
153005
script pubkey
OP_0 OP_PUSHBYTES_32 d30bb84e723725996bacc3fa61aec5492e3c81fedf0ab71213ba962ba4ead11e
address
bc1q6v9msnnjxujej6avc0axrtk9fyhreq07mu9twysnh2tzhf826y0qvz2cj3
transaction
43cacc114b1ee15dea30266f91432f20ba3abfd596bc934651d9827899836b96
spent
true